.b_auth_modal{
    .errors_all{margin-bottom: 15px;}
    &.login {[data-name="password"]{margin-bottom: 0;}}
    &.registartion {[data-name="confirm_password"]{margin-bottom: 0;}}
    .forgot_password{
        width: 100%;
        margin-bottom: 15px;
        display: block;
        cursor: pointer;

        font-size: 14px;
        color: var(--hovered_text_color);
        text-align: right;
    }

    &.logout_modal{
        --modal-header_margin_btm: 0;
        --modal-inf-padding: 15px 15px 10px 15px;

        .info_text{
            font-size: 16px;
            margin: 0 0 15px 0;
        }

        .logout{
            margin-bottom: 5px;
        }
    }

    &.registration_modal{
        .already_registered{
            display: flex;
            align-items: center;
            gap: 2px;

            font-size: 14px;

            a{transition: color 0.3s ease;color: #0096cd;}
        }
    }

    &.login_modal{
    }

    &.logout_modal{
    }
}